web前端程序学什么

时间:2025-01-25 14:55:52 手机游戏

Web前端程序的学习内容主要包括以下几个方面:

HTML

定义:HTML(Hyper Text Markup Language,超文本标记语言)是用来描述网页内容和结构的标记语言。

常用元素和标签:学习HTML的常用元素和标签,如段落、标题、链接、列表、表格等,以便构建网页的基本结构。

CSS

定义:CSS(Cascading Style Sheets,层叠样式表)是用来描述网页外观和格式的计算机语言。

样式和布局:学习CSS的基本语法和选择器,掌握如何应用样式和布局,如颜色、字体、边距、填充、响应式设计等。

JavaScript

定义:JavaScript是一种直译式脚本语言,用于实现网页的交互效果和动态功能。

基本语法和编程:学习JavaScript的基本语法、数据类型、运算符、语句和函数,掌握DOM操作、事件处理、Ajax等核心技能。

前端框架和库

常见框架:学习并掌握常用的前端框架,如Vue.js、React、Angular等,这些框架可以帮助提高开发效率和代码质量。

库和工具:了解并学习一些常用的库和工具,如jQuery、Bootstrap等,这些工具可以简化开发过程。

响应式设计

概念和实践:学习如何使网页能够适应不同的屏幕尺寸和设备,提升用户体验。

版本控制和协作

版本控制工具:学习使用Git等版本控制工具,进行代码管理和团队协作。

后端技术和API

基本了解:了解一些后端开发的基本知识,如HTTP协议、API接口等,以便与后端开发进行协作。

用户体验设计

UI/UX设计:学习如何设计用户界面和用户体验,使网页具有良好的可用性和易用性。

浏览器开发工具

调试和性能优化:学习使用浏览器开发工具进行代码调试和性能优化。

项目实战和案例分析

项目经验:通过实际项目案例的积累,增加对实际软件项目开发的经验,提升分析和解决问题的能力。

建议

系统学习:建议系统学习前端开发的基础知识,从HTML、CSS和JavaScript开始,逐步深入到前端框架和库的学习。

实践为主:多动手实践,通过编写代码和完成项目来巩固所学知识。

持续学习:前端技术更新换代快,需要不断学习和跟进最新的技术和工具,保持竞争力。

团队协作:前端开发常常需要与设计、后端开发以及产品经理等不同角色进行沟通协作,因此提高团队协作和沟通能力也非常重要。